Local Insight

The college admissions landscape in Providence is highly competitive, with many talented students vying for limited spots at top universities. To stand out, it's essential to achieve a strong SAT score that aligns with your target schools. For instance, Brown University typically admits students with SAT scores between 1370 and 1530, while Providence College looks for scores between 1140 and 1350. Rhode Island College and Johnson & Wales University also have specific SAT score requirements, ranging from 910 to 1110 and 960 to 1170, respectively. The SAT and ACT are both standardized tests used for college admissions, but they have distinct differences in terms of format, content, and scoring. The SAT focuses on reasoning and problem-solving skills, with an emphasis on math and evidence-based reading and writing. The ACT, on the other hand, tests more straightforward math and reading comprehension skills.
